#707323 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#707323 is composed of 43.9% red, 45.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 62.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#707323 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0e646 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#707323 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#707323 has RGB values of R:112, G:115,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7369507.

Shades and Tints of #707323
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a03 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#707323
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505046 is the less saturated color, while #909600 is the most saturated one.
